Organisations that can develop resilience and agility are better able to survive turbulent times and thrive. In Knowledge Transfer: The Key to Organizational Resilience and Agility, Chris Cancialosi explores how talent development professionals are positioned to have a positive impact on companies’ efforts to prepare for and prosper in today’s new operating environment.
How do organisations not only survive, but thrive in today’s new operating environment? By developing resilience and agility. Knowledge transfer is critical to this, and talent development practitioners are positioned to help companies prepare. In Knowledge Transfer: The Key to Organizational Resilience and Agility, Chris Cancialosi details:
What knowledge transfer is and why it is critical to organisations’ resilience and agility
The role of effective knowledge transfer in the future of workways to develop and strengthen an organisation’s ability to effectively transfer and manage knowledge.

Chris Cancialosi is an organizational psychologist and founding partner of gothamCulture. He has consulted with organizations in a wide variety of industries, including some of the world’s most recognized brands. He is also a regular contributor to Forbes.com and other media outlets.
